Cannot connect to the internet!


Hello!
I am a Linux newbie and have installed Red Hat Enterprise Linux 4 AS kernel 2.6.xx on my P-4. My mother board is Intel 865GBF. I have no LAN cards installed.
I am trying to get my box to connect to the net, but in vain.
I am located in India and use a Huawei MT882 ADSL broadband modem with GlobespanVirata SmartAX MT882 chipset. I also use Win Xp (dual boot), and connect in XP using PPPoE, using a USB connection.
I tried setting up my connection in Linux, however I cannot activate the connection. The USB, Power, Link lights on my modem are all lit ok, but the 'Active' light does not even glow for a second. When I click on the 'activate' button in the i-net config. wizard, after a lot of time, I get a cryptic message saying 'Cannot activate!- TERMINATED Adsl-Connect line xxxx connect>/dev/nul &2>1' or something similar.
